Free Zone or Mainland? Now You Can Have Both
The biggest news in 2025 was a new rule that lets free zone companies sell on the mainland without creating a second company. You just need a simple permit. This change saved our clients time and money.
Lesson: Don’t choose between free zone (100% ownership, zero tax) and mainland (sell anywhere in UAE) anymore. Many businesses now start in a free zone and add mainland access later. It’s the smartest way to grow fast.
Corporate Tax Is Here | Plan Early
The 9% corporate tax is now normal. Free zone companies still pay 0% if they follow the rules, but mistakes are expensive.
Lesson: Talk to a tax expert on day one. Good records and clear contracts keep your tax rate at zero. We saw many clients save thousands of dirhams just by planning ahead.
Visas Became Easier and More Powerful
New visas for AI experts, teachers, doctors, and green-energy workers arrived in 2025. Family sponsorship is now possible with just AED 4,000 monthly income. Golden Visas and remote setups also grew fast.
Lesson: The right visa brings the right people. Clients who used investor or talent visas doubled their teams in months. Get the visa first, everything else (bank account, office) becomes simple after that.

Money Tips: Keep Costs Low, But Don’t Skip Compliance
Low-cost free zones like Sharjah and Ajman became very popular. Packages under AED 10,000 with virtual offices worked perfectly for online businesses.
Lesson: The license is cheap; surprises are not. Budget a little extra for proper tax advice and yearly renewals. It always pays back.
